We've had a couple of really busy weeks! Jack saw his eye doctor last week. Jack's left eye is still turning in quite a bit, so we are to continue patching two hours a day and he also prescribed glasses to help strengthen Jack's eye muscles. If the glasses and patch don’t stop the turning in of his eyes he may need surgery. My heart sank when he said that. I understand it’s a “simple” surgery but I am still not prepared to watch him go through anything like that. I’ve sort of been proud and relieved that he hasn’t had any surgery since the NICU. It’s coming up on three years since his first/last surgery. So I am determined to take the glasses seriously and wear them on him religiously.

We finally have an appointment for an evaluation for Botox injections!!!!! We go to CHOP On January 21st and about two weeks later the injections will be scheduled. At CHOP they do the injections under sedation. This is so they can be very, very precise with which muscles they inject the botox. I am a little nervous about the sedation, but trust that this is the best way for Jack at this age.
